Emera Incorporated (TSE:EMA - Free Report) - Equities research analysts at Raymond James increased their FY2025 EPS estimates for Emera in a research note issued to investors on Sunday, February 23rd. Raymond James analyst T. Genzebu now forecasts that the company will post earnings per share of $3.23 for the year, up from their previous forecast of $3.22. The consensus estimate for Emera's current full-year earnings is $3.20 per share. Raymond James also issued estimates for Emera's Q4 2025 earnings at $0.90 EPS.
Other equities research analysts have also recently issued research reports about the stock. National Bankshares boosted their target price on shares of Emera from C$54.00 to C$55.00 in a research report on Thursday, December 5th. Royal Bank of Canada boosted their price objective on shares of Emera from C$60.00 to C$63.00 in a report on Monday. BMO Capital Markets increased their target price on shares of Emera from C$58.00 to C$60.00 in a research report on Monday. CIBC lifted their price target on shares of Emera from C$58.00 to C$59.00 in a research report on Monday. Finally, Wells Fargo & Company boosted their price target on Emera from C$51.00 to C$56.00 in a research note on Monday, December 9th. Three anal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ating, seven have issued a buy rating and one has issued a strong buy rating to the company. According to MarketBeat, Emera has a consensus rating of "Moderate Buy" and a consensus price target of C$58.10.

Emera Stock Performance
EMA traded up C$0.42 during trading on Tuesday, hitting C$57.86. The stock had a trading volume of 2,424,168 shares, compared to its average volume of 1,596,739.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 150.23, a current ratio of 0.72 and a quick ratio of 0.23. The company has a 50 day moving average price of C$54.73 and a 200-day moving average price of C$52.94. Emera has a one year low of C$44.13 and a one year high of C$58.73. The firm has a market cap of C$16.97 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 22.43, a P/E/G ratio of 6.20 and a beta of 0.35.
Emera Dividend Announcement
The firm also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Friday, February 14th. Investors of record on Friday, February 14th were given a dividend of $0.725 per share. The ex-dividend date was Friday, January 31st. This represents a $2.90 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 5.01%. Emera's dividend payout ratio is currently 112.40%.

Emera Incorporated, through its subsidiaries, engages in the generation, transmission, and distribution of electricity to various customers. The company operates through Florida Electric Utility, Canadian Electric Utilities, Other Electric Utilities, Gas Utilities and Infrastructure, and Other segments.
